Produce and Herbs--22 weeks

Produce and Herb Shares:  Weekly shares of from 5 to 10 vegetables and herbs selected from a wide range of items that vary with the seasons. Deliveries are made in wax vegetable boxes, and customers return their prior week’s box when they pick up the current box.  Most vegetables will be certified organic from Harland's Creek Farm and Pine Knot Farms.  Roberson Creek Farm and occasionally Fickle Creek Farm will provide sustainably grown items.  A weekly e-mail will let you know which farm each item came from.  22 weeks $470

Meat Shares--22 weeks

Meat Shares:  Pasture raised beef, chicken, and pork will be provided on a rotating basis.  We are offering a gourmet share and a family share this year, with the former including smaller amounts of more expensive cuts such as steaks and chops and the latter having larger amounts of less expensive cuts such as ground beef, chicken leg quarters, stew beef, and so on. $416 and $350 respectively.

Cheese Shares--22 weeks

Cheese Shares:  Weekly cheese selected from the seven kinds of cheese made by Chapel Hill Creamery including camembert like Carolina Moon and New Moon, mozzarella, farmers cheese, feta, an aged cheese called Hickory Grove, and the award winning Calvander cheese which won a gold medal in the hard cheese category at the North American Jersey Cheese Show and was second best in show. This cheese is similar to Asiago

Fall Extension Produce and Herbs

Fall Extension which will include seven deliveries beginning on Saturday, October 6, 2012 and ending the Saturday before Thanksgiving.  Pick-ups for the Fall Extension will be at the Saturday Durham Farmers’ Market.  The produce and herb box will be somewhat smaller in the fall and will feature a double share of goodies the week before Thanksgiving.$120
